Fixture for environmental protection equipment
By designing a support block and clamping mechanism for environmental protection equipment clamps, the shortcomings of existing clamps in terms of clamping effect and adaptability are solved, and stable clamping and transfer of environmental protection equipment of different sizes are realized.

AI Technical Summary
Existing environmental protection equipment clamps have poor clamping effect during transportation and cannot adapt to environmental protection equipment with different diameters and widths, which limits their effectiveness.
A clamp comprising four support blocks and a clamping mechanism was designed. By adjusting the distance between the support blocks and using a clamping plate to firmly attach to the surface of the environmental protection equipment, it can be adapted to environmental protection equipment of different sizes.
It enables stable clamping and transfer of environmental protection equipment of different sizes, facilitates crane operation, and improves the flexibility and adaptability of clamping.

TECHNICAL FIELD
[0001] The application relates to the technical field of a clamp for environmental protection equipment, in particular to a clamp for environmental protection equipment. BACKGROUND
[0002] The environmental protection equipment refers to mechanical products, structures and systems manufactured and built by production units or construction and installation units for controlling environmental pollution and improving environmental quality, and some people believe that the environmental protection equipment refers to mechanical processing products for treating environmental pollution, such as dust collectors, welding fume purifiers, single water treatment equipment, noise controllers and the like, which is not comprehensive, the environmental protection equipment should also include power equipment for conveying fluid substances containing pollutants, such as water pumps, fans and conveyors, and simultaneously includes monitoring and control instruments for ensuring normal operation of pollution prevention and control facilities, such as detection instruments, pressure gauges and flow monitoring devices, commonly used environmental protection equipment in a factory includes dust removal equipment, air purification equipment and waste collection equipment, and the environmental protection equipment needs to be clamped and positioned during installation and fixation, therefore, a clamp for environmental protection equipment is particularly needed.
[0003] The application number is CN202321637844.8, and the clamp for environmental protection equipment comprises a base and a lifting mechanism, the lifting mechanism comprises a sliding groove, a rotating shaft, a first threaded rod, a sliding block and a first handle, the outer surface of the base is fixedly connected with a gasket, the outer surface of the base is provided with the lifting mechanism, the outer surface of the lifting mechanism is provided with a connecting plate, the outer surface of the connecting plate is provided with a fixing mechanism, and the outer surface of the fixing mechanism is provided with an environmental protection equipment body. The clamp for environmental protection equipment is provided with the lifting mechanism, after the fixing of the environmental protection equipment body is completed, the first handle is first rotated, the first threaded rod is rotated on the outer surface of the base through the rotating shaft, the rotation of the first threaded rod is converted into the linear motion of the sliding block on the inner surface of the sliding groove, and then the environmental protection equipment body is moved to a suitable position, and the height adjustment of the environmental protection equipment body is completed.
[0004] However, the clamp has poor clamping effect when the environmental protection equipment is transported, and has certain limitations when the environmental protection equipment with different diameters is transported, that is, the clamp can only clamp and transport the environmental protection equipment with different lengths, and cannot clamp and transport the environmental protection equipment with different widths, therefore, the clamp for environmental protection equipment is provided by the person skilled in the art to solve the problems in the background art. Content of the utility model
[0005] In order to solve the problems in the background art, the application provides a clamp for environmental protection equipment.
[0006] The clamp for environmental protection equipment provided by the application adopts the following technical scheme:
[0007] The utility model provides a fixture for environmental protection equipment, including four support blocks, four the support block is squarely arranged, the upper end of support block bears environmental protection equipment body, is provided with the link board between two adjacent support blocks, one side of link board is provided with clamping mechanism, clamping mechanism includes inclined plate, the upper end of link board is movably installed with the inclined plate, and one end of inclined plate is movably connected with connecting plate, one end of connecting plate is movably connected with clamping plate through pivot, the upper end of link board is fixedly installed with cylinder, and the top of cylinder is movably clamped with threaded sleeve, the inside of threaded sleeve is threadedly connected with screw rod.
[0008] Preferably, the lower end of the connecting plate is fixedly installed with an active connection shaft, and the top of the screw rod is movably connected with the active connection shaft.
[0009] Preferably, the upper end of the support block is fixedly installed with an L-shaped limiting block, and a plurality of rubber pads are fixedly installed on the inner side of the L-shaped limiting block at the upper end of the support block, and a roller is movably installed at the lower end of the support block.
[0010] Preferably, guide plates are fixedly installed on both sides of the support block, and a plurality of threaded holes are horizontally and equidistantly formed in the upper end of the guide plate.
[0011] Preferably, the other end of the guide plate penetrates the inside of the link plate, and a limiting bolt is threadedly connected with one of the threaded holes at the lower end of the link plate.
[0012] In summary, the present application has the following beneficial technical effects: by setting four support blocks, rotating the limiting bolt, making the limiting bolt fall off the threaded hole on the surface of the guide plate, adjusting the length of the guide plate, adjusting the distance between the support blocks, matching environmental protection equipment bodies of different sizes, after adjustment, limiting and fixing the four support blocks by the limiting bolt, and contacting the four corners of the environmental protection equipment body on the inner side of the L-shaped limiting block by the crane, thereby facilitating the transfer of the environmental protection equipment body.
[0013] By setting the clamping mechanism, the four clamping plates are located at the four sides of the environmental protection equipment body, as shown in Figure 1 , rotating the threaded sleeve, moving the screw rod into the cylinder, thereby tensioning the connecting plate, making the clamping plate tightly adhere to the surface of the environmental protection equipment body, and clamping and positioning. Specific implementation
[0019] In order to make the technical means, creative features, purposes and effects of the utility model easy to understand, the utility model is further described below in combination with specific implementation modes.
[0020] As Figures 1-4 shown, a clamp for environmental protection equipment, including four support blocks 1, four support blocks 1 are squarely arranged, the upper end of support block 1 bears environmental protection equipment body 2, two adjacent support blocks 1 are provided with link plate 7, one side of link plate 7 is provided with clamping mechanism 3, clamping mechanism 3 includes inclined plate 11, inclined plate 11 is movably installed on the upper end of link plate 7, and one end of inclined plate 11 movably connects with connecting plate 12, one end of connecting plate 12 movably connects with clamping plate 13 through the rotating shaft, the upper end of link plate 7 is fixedly installed with cylinder 14, and the top of cylinder 14 movably clamps threaded sleeve 15, the inside of threaded sleeve 15 is screw-connected with screw 16, first, the position between four support blocks 1 is adjusted according to the length and width of environmental protection equipment body 2, four support blocks 1 are set, rotating limiting bolt 10, makes limiting bolt 10 and the threaded hole 9 on the surface of guide plate 8 fall off, then the length of guide plate 8 is adjusted, thereby the distance between support blocks 1 is adjusted, matches the environmental protection equipment body 2 of different sizes, after adjusting, four support blocks 1 are fixedly positioned by limiting bolt 10, the four corners of environmental protection equipment body 2 are contacted on the inside of L type limiting block 4 by crane, thereby the transfer of environmental protection equipment body 2 is convenient.
[0021] In the embodiment, the lower end of connecting plate 12 is fixedly installed with movable connecting shaft 17, and the top of screw 16 is movably connected with movable connecting shaft 17, four clamping plates 13 are located at the four sides of environmental protection equipment body 2 by setting clamping mechanism 3, as Figure 1 shown, rotating threaded sleeve 15, screw 16 moves to the inside of cylinder 14, thereby connecting plate 12 can be pulled tight, and clamping plate 13 is tightly attached to the surface of environmental protection equipment body 2, clamping positioning is carried out.
[0022] In the embodiment, the upper end of the supporting block 1 is fixedly provided with an L-shaped limiting block 4, and the upper end of the supporting block 1 is fixedly provided with a plurality of rubber pads 5 inside the L-shaped limiting block 4, and the lower end of the supporting block 1 is movably provided with a roller 6.
[0023] In the embodiment, the two sides of the supporting block 1 are fixedly provided with guide plates 8, and the upper end of the guide plate 8 is horizontally and equidistantly provided with a plurality of threaded holes 9.
[0024] In the embodiment, the other end of the guide plate 8 penetrates the inside of the connecting plate 7, the lower end of the connecting plate 7 is threadedly penetrated by a limiting bolt 10, and the limiting bolt 10 is threadedly connected with one of the threaded holes 9.
[0025] The implementation principle of the clamp for the environmental protection equipment is as follows: first, the positions between the four supporting blocks 1 are adjusted according to the length and width of the environmental protection equipment body 2, the limiting bolt 10 is rotated to make the limiting bolt 10 fall off the threaded hole 9 on the surface of the guide plate 8, and then the length of the guide plate 8 is adjusted to adjust the distance between the supporting blocks 1, so as to match the environmental protection equipment body 2 of different sizes, after the adjustment is completed, the four supporting blocks 1 are fixedly limited by the limiting bolt 10, the four corners of the environmental protection equipment body 2 are abutted on the inside of the L-shaped limiting block 4 by the crane, so as to facilitate the transfer of the environmental protection equipment body 2, the four clamping plates 13 are located at the four sides of the environmental protection equipment body 2 by the clamping mechanism 3, the threaded sleeve 15 is rotated to move the screw rod 16 to the inside of the cylinder 14, so as to tighten the connecting plate 12 and make the clamping plate 13 tightly adhere to the surface of the environmental protection equipment body 2 for clamping and positioning.
